www.ctrt.net > jAvA为什么自动换行

jAvA为什么自动换行

Java中如果使用System.out.println()方法,是会自动换行的。 如果不需要自动换行,可以使用System.out.print()直接打印信息。

System.out.println(); 就是输出换行,要输出不换行就用 System.out.print();

不换行输出System.out.print() 换行输出System.out.println()

println() 就是输出后换行 print() 就是输出后不换行 这两个输出方法就是一个换行与不换行的区别

JTextArea 下的方法自动换行 public void setLineWrap(boolean wrap) 添加文本时,添加\n换行

TextArea有个方法为setLineWrap(boolean wrap) ,将参数设为True,就可以自动换行 如果是想每一次输入都是换行的话,那就在在上一次输入的最后加一个“\r\n”。 举个例子: jTextArea.append("输入内容"+"\r\n"); 这样,每次输入的话,都是另起一...

你想要的是JTextArea的自动换行吧 JTextArea.setLineWrap(true);//激活自动换行功能 JTextArea.setWrapStyleWord(true);//激活断行不断字功能

f.getContentPane().add(BorderLayout.EAST, p); 这句就把p固定死了还怎么自动换行。

输入这么多还是用 type=“text” 吧

使用SwingX库提供的JXLabel: JXLabel multiline = new JXLabel("this is a \nMultiline Text");multiline.setLineWrap(true);

网站地图

All rights reserved Powered by www.ctrt.net

copyright ©right 2010-2021。
www.ctrt.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com